how to write an app for android phone with chatgpt

 




銀髮族 AI 學習週記:如何寫出一個 Android 手機應用程式

從零開始也不怕的簡單入門指南

隨著智慧手機越來越普及,很多銀髮族也開始好奇:「我能不能自己寫一個手機 App 呢?」
答案是 —— 可以的!而且現在比以往更簡單。


🌱 一、從想法開始

你不需要是工程師,也不需要懂程式碼。
只要有一個好主意,例如:

  • 幫長者記錄每日瑣事的提醒 App

  • 幫乒乓球愛好者提升知識、技術與體能的小工具

  • 幫家人安排用藥時間或運動計畫的 App

只要有明確的用途與對象,就能開始設計!


🧩 二、選擇無需程式的開發工具

現在有許多 免寫程式 (no-code) 平台,適合初學者:

  1. AppSheet(Google 出品):可直接用 Google Sheet 製作 App,非常適合管理資料與提醒功能。

  2. Glide:更注重美觀與互動,操作像做簡報一樣簡單。

  3. ThunkableKodular:拖拉式介面,可設計出更複雜的互動。

這些工具都能製作 Android(甚至 iPhone)版本。


🧠 三、實作步驟簡介

AppSheet 為例:

  1. 準備好 Google Sheet(例如有日期、事項、提醒時間等欄位)。

  2. 登入 AppSheet.com

  3. 點選「Start with your own data」,選擇你的 Google Sheet。

  4. AppSheet 會自動分析資料並生成一個可操作的 App。

  5. 你可以自訂圖示、顏色、按鈕、提醒通知等功能。

只需幾個步驟,就能把你的想法變成一個「會動的」App!


📱 四、如何在 Android 手機上使用

完成後:

  1. 你可以用手機掃描 QR Code 或點選 AppSheet 提供的連結。

  2. App 會在 Android 手機上以「Web App」方式打開。

  3. 若想安裝成圖示,可選擇「Add to Home Screen(加入主畫面)」。
    以後只要一點,就能像普通 App 一樣使用。


💡 五、從小做起,慢慢成長

第一次做 App,重點不是複雜功能,而是:

  • 🧭 清楚目的(幫誰解決什麼問題)

  • 🪄 簡單操作(少按鈕、大字體)

  • 💬 不斷測試與改進

慢慢地,你會發現——
原來寫 App 也是一種創作與學習的樂趣!

👨‍💻 AI Learning for Seniors: How to Build an Android App

A Simple, Friendly Guide for Beginners

With smartphones everywhere, many seniors wonder:
“Can I make my own mobile app?”
The good news — yes, you can! And it’s much easier than it sounds.


🌱 1. Start with an Idea

You don’t need coding skills or technical background — just imagination!
Think of something simple, like:

  • A daily reminder app for seniors,

  • A ping pong training assistant,

  • A medicine or activity tracker for your family.

Once you have a purpose, you’re ready to begin.


🧩 2. Choose a No-Code Tool

Modern tools let anyone build apps without writing a single line of code:

  1. AppSheet (by Google) – perfect for data-based apps using Google Sheets.

  2. Glide – beautifully designed, easy to use like PowerPoint.

  3. Thunkable or Kodular – for those who want more customization.

All of these can create Android (and even iPhone) apps.


🧠 3. How It Works (AppSheet Example)

  1. Prepare a Google Sheet with your app data (like date, reminder, time).

  2. Go to AppSheet.com.

  3. Click “Start with your own data” and select your Google Sheet.

  4. AppSheet automatically builds your app structure.

  5. Customize the design, buttons, and notification features.

You’ll have a working prototype in minutes — no programming needed!


📱 4. Use It on Your Android Phone

After creating your app:

  1. Scan the QR code or click the AppSheet link.

  2. It opens directly on your phone as a web app.

  3. Tap “Add to Home Screen” to install it like a regular app.

Now your own creation lives on your phone!


💡 5. Start Small, Learn Fast

Focus on simplicity:

  • 🧭 Clear purpose,

  • 🪄 Big buttons and readable fonts,

  • 💬 Try, test, and tweak gradually.

Over time, you’ll discover the joy of creating — it’s a learning journey, not a race.
